LAWYER CHALLENGES ZAMFARA GOVERNMENT IN COURT OVER BAN ON POLITICAL GATHERINGS IN THE STATE

A legal practitioner and indigene of Zamfara State, Barrister Mohammed Kanoma, has taken the state government to court, challenging the ban on political gatherings and rallies in the state.

Kanoma filed the suit before Justice Salim Ibrahim of the Federal High Court in Gusau, the Zamfara State capital, challenging the legality and constitutionality of the Executive Order.

The lawyer argued that the ban infringes on fundamental human rights, particularly the rights to freedom of assembly and association as guaranteed by the Nigerian Constitution.

He urged the court to declare the Executive Order null and void and to compel the Zamfara State Government to lift the ban immediately.
